WHO IS SUITABLE FOR THE SAMBA BUTTOCK IMPLANTS?

Implants are an option to be considered when:

  • Your buttocks are underdeveloped, small, flat, crinkled, or not in proportion to the rest of the body;
  • The shape between the legs - buttocks do not have attractive accents;
  • The outer cheek of the thigh is defective;
  • You feel no confident in a sexy outfit.
Frequently asked questions (FAQ) about Buttock surgery:
 
 Q: Are buttock implants dangerous?
Buttock implants are inserted away from areas containing important nerves and are not placed under the bony area of the buttock region which you use to sit down on. And for a safe and successful buttock implants procedure, post-operation there are some really important instructions that you need to follow. Also, the immediate aftercare may be as important as the surgery itself.
 
 Q: Will my results look natural?
A: Customer will have the accurate diagnosis and results afterwards through VECTRA XT 3D imaging system. Our surgeons will offer suggestions to achieve balanced proportions not only on the buttocks, but throughout the body. Viewing and discussing these simulated photos with our doctors will help guide them in performing your surgery to your specifications so that you are sure to love the end result!
 
 Q: Will augmentation/enlargement work for me if I have saggy buttocks?
A: It depends on how much your buttocks sag. If you have mild sagging buttocks, you can receive implants and fat to enlarge your buttocks because they can fill up a loose skin envelope, making the buttocks look full again. 
 
Q: Do i need to exchange the buttock implants?
A: If they aren’t broken there is really not reason to exchange/replace them unless you're not happy with the size anymore.

PREPARE FOR YOUR SURGERY
  • Strictly NO food and drink including water for 6-8 hours before surgery. Having food or drink in your system could cause complications from the anesthesia,
  • Stop smoking before your procedure for a few weeks to avoid nicotine-related risks,
  • Do not take medications that could increase bleeding, such as non-steroidal anti-inflammatories and aspirin. Avoid supplements that have similar effects, like vitamin E and fish oil,
  • You must be cleared for surgery by appropriate pre-surgery screening (blood test, EKG, X-ray, ultrasound etc.) in accordance with your surgeon's instructions and our Patient Safety requirements,
  • Choose clothes that will be comfortable (loose-fitting clothes and slip-on shoes). You shouldn't wear contact lenses, accessories like jewelry, watches, wigs or hairpins. Do not apply any products to your skin or hair the morning of surgery,
  • Line up a family member or friend to drive you home after your procedure or post-operative care since you will be receiving anesthesia.
PROCESS
 
Buttock implant surgery is performed under general anaesthetic, meaning you will be unconscious for the entire procedure which takes about 1.5-2 hours in the operating room. Our surgeon will make 2 small incisions in the "natural crease" to insert implants. A pocket will be created to hold the implant, then implant is inserted into the pocket on each side of the buttocks. Our surgeons will carefully examine the region to ensure the results are symmetrical and look natural.
In general, more complex procedures performed on larger areas will take longer to heal. The recovery time varies by patient and tends to be between 1 – 3 weeks. Most patients don’t experience a great deal of pain. You’re likely to feel tired and sore for a few days. Most of your discomfort will be well-controlled by the prescribed medication.
 
 
You need to avoid sitting on your buttocks, other than using the restroom, or climbing flights of stairs for at least two weeks. You can lay on your tummy for the first two weeks, it may be possible to place yourself into a fairly comfortable position on your backside with your knees and ankles elevated upon 2 to 3 pillows thus transferring some of your weight from the buttock up to the mid-back region. Sleeping on the side is also prohibited for 3 weeks. It will be close to a month before you can sit and lie normally, and you may still experience some tenderness for several months. While your results should be noticeable immediately, it may take up to six months before you do not feel the presence of the implants in your body.
